How Tile and Grout Material Affects Cleaning Costs
Not all tiles are created equal; the type of tile and grout you select can greatly impact your cleaning expenses. For example, ceramic tiles are often easier to clean compared to natural stone tiles, which typically require more specialised care. Additionally, grout varies in density and colour, with some types offering enhanced resistance to stains. If you are dealing with sensitive materials like marble or limestone, it is vital to seek professional assistance, as harsh cleaning agents can cause irreversible damage.
The different types of tiles and grout also dictate the cleaning solutions that will be employed. For instance, eco-friendly alternatives might come with additional costs but will safeguard your surfaces while positively impacting the environment. Thus, understanding the materials of your tiles and grout is not only beneficial for aesthetics; it’s a crucial aspect of efficiently managing your budget when you discover the true cost of tile and grout cleaning in Worcester Park today.

Breaking Down Standard Rates for Tile and Grout Cleaning Services
Let’s delve into the financial aspects—the standard rates you can anticipate for basic tile and grout cleaning services in Worcester Park. Typically, you can expect to pay about £20-£30 per hour for standard cleaning services. This pricing generally covers a thorough cleaning of your tiles and grout, which includes the removal of common stains and dirt accumulation.
However, it’s important to remember that this figure is just a starting point. Various elements, including the size of the area and the condition of your tiles and grout, will influence the final price. If your space has been neglected for years, you may find that the required time exceeds the standard estimate. Always engage in a comprehensive discussion with your cleaning company to ensure you receive a complete quote that accurately reflects the actual scope of work required.

Exploring Additional Treatment Options for Superior Results

As you explore the realm of tile and grout cleaning, you may discover various additional treatment options that can substantially enhance the appearance of your surfaces. Treatments like sealing can add anywhere from £10 to £20 per square metre and are undoubtedly a worthwhile investment. Sealing creates a protective barrier for your grout against future stains, simplifying cleaning and lowering your long-term maintenance costs.
Moreover, specialised treatments tailored for specific types of tiles or stubborn stains can be particularly advantageous for homeowners eager to maintain a pristine look without the constant concern of stains or build-up. Always ask about the availability of additional treatments when consulting with professionals; this inquiry could lead to considerable time and effort savings in the future.

Selecting Appropriate Cleaning Products for Optimal Care
Utilising the correct cleaning products is critical for maintaining the beauty and durability of your tiles and grout. Avoid harsh chemicals that could harm delicate surfaces. Instead, opt for pH-balanced cleaners that effectively eliminate dirt and grime without causing damage.
Before embarking on a DIY cleaning approach, conduct thorough research to identify the best products suitable for your specific tile and grout types. Certain materials require special care, and using inappropriate products could lead to costly repairs. A bit of research can go a long way in ensuring your surfaces remain in excellent condition, keeping future cleaning costs manageable.
The Benefits of Investing in Grout Sealing
One of the most effective methods for protecting your grout is to invest in sealing services. Sealing your grout creates a barrier against stains and moisture, simplifying future cleaning efforts. This straightforward measure can significantly reduce the necessity for deep cleaning services and extend the lifespan of your grout.
Consider scheduling sealing services after a professional cleaning to ensure your grout is protected right from the start. Taking this proactive step can save you money over time, allowing you to enjoy beautiful, stain-free grout without the anxiety of future cleaning emergencies.

Common Questions About Tile and Grout Cleaning
What is the average cost for tile and grout cleaning in Worcester Park?
The average cost typically ranges from £20 to £30 per hour for basic cleaning services and can increase to £40 to £60 per hour for deep cleaning or restoration.
How can I maintain my tiles and grout between professional cleanings?
Regularly clean your tiles with a gentle cleaner, promptly address stains, and consider sealing your grout to protect against future damage.
Are there DIY options available for cleaning tiles and grout?
Yes, DIY options are available, but they may not yield professional results. It’s crucial to use the right products and techniques to avoid damaging your tiles.
How often should I have my grout professionally cleaned?
It’s advisable to have your grout professionally cleaned every 12-18 months, depending on usage and exposure to dirt and moisture.
Can neglected grout be restored?
Yes, neglected grout can often be restored with proper cleaning and sealing; however, extensive damage may require replacement.
